Canon PowerShot S70 Review based on a production Canon PowerShot S70On August the 19th of this year Canon announced a new flagship addition to its successful S range, the 7 megapixel PowerShot S70. Aside from the black paint job and new sensor the S70 is identical to the PowerShot S60 (reviewed August 2004), sharing that models new slim body design, wideangle lens and improved movie mode.
